Noun

edit

kamiyń m inan

  1. stone (piece of rock that has been separated)
    • 2017, Charles Dickens, translated by Grzegorz Kulik, Godniŏ pieśń [A Christmas Carol]‎[1], 1 edition, Opole: Silesia Progress, →ISBN:
      Stary Marley bōł umarty choby kamiyń.
      Old Marley was dead as a stone.
  2. (historical) stone (unit of mass equal to 32 pounds)
